CVE-2018-10894

Related Vulnerabilities: CVE-2018-10894  

It was found that SAML authentication in Keycloak 3.4.3.Final incorrectly authenticated expired certificates. A malicious user could use this to access unauthorized data or possibly conduct further attacks.

CVSS v3 metrics

CVSS3 Base Score 5.4
CVSS3 Base Metrics CVSS:3.0/AV:N/AC:L/PR:L/UI:N/S:U/C:L/I:L/A:N
Attack Vector Network
Attack Complexity Low
Privileges Required Low
User Interaction None
Scope Unchanged
Confidentiality Low
Integrity Impact Low
Availability Impact None

Red Hat Security Errata

Platform Errata Release Date
Red Hat Single Sign-On 7.1 for RHEL 7 Server (rh-sso7-keycloak) RHSA-2018:3593 2018-11-13
Red Hat Single Sign-On 7.2 RHSA-2018:3595 2018-11-13
Red Hat Single Sign-On 7.1 for RHEL 6 Server (rh-sso7-keycloak) RHSA-2018:3592 2018-11-13
